HOLIDAYS 2023 – Maharashtra Government Public or Closed Holidays and Optional or Restricted Holidays for the year 2023
GENERAL ADMINISTRATION DEPARTMENT
Mantralaya, Madam Cama Road, Hutatma Rajguru Chowk,
Mumbai 400 032, dated the 2nd December 2022.
NOTIFICATION
PUBLIC HOLIDAYS––2023
No. PHD-1122/C.R.117/Desk-29.— In exercise of the powers of Central Government under section 25 of the Negotiable Instruments Act, 1881 (XXVI of 1881) entrusted to it by the Government of India, Ministry of Home Affairs vide its Notification No.39/I/68/JUDI-III/dated the 8th May 1968,the Government of Maharashtra hereby declares the following days as Public Holidays in the State of Maharashtra during the calendar year 2023 :—

(A) Public Holidays
Republic Day | 26th January 2023 | Thursday |
Mahashivratri | 18th February 2023 | Saturday |
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Jayanti | 19th February 2023 | Sunday |
Holi (Second Day) | 07th March 2023 | Tuesday |
Gudhi Padwa | 22nd March 2023 | Wednesday |
Ram Navami | 30th March 2023 | Thursday |
Mahavir Jayanti | 04th April 2023 | Tuesday |
Good Friday | 07th April 2023 | Friday |
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ar Jayanti | 14th April 2023 | Friday |
Ramzan-Id (Id-Ul-Fitr) (Shawal-1) | 22nd April 2023 | Saturday |
Maharashtra Din | 1st May 2023 | Monday |
Buddha Pournima | 5th May 2023 | Friday |
Bakri Id (Id-Uz-Zuha) | 28th June 2023 | Wednesday |
Moharum | 29th July 2023 | Saturday |
Independence Day | 15th August 2023 | Tuesday |
Parsi New Year (Shahenshahi) | 16th August 2023 | Wednesday |
Ganesh Chaturthi | 19th September 2023 | Tuesday |
Id-E-Milad | 28th September 2023 | Thursday |
Mahatma Gandhi Jayanti | 2nd October 2023 | Monday |
Dasara | 24th October 2023 | Tuesday |
Diwali Amavasya (Laxmi Pujan) | 12th November 2023 | Sunday |
Diwali (Bali Pratipada) | 14th November 2023 | Tuesday |
Guru Nanak Jayanti | 27th November 2023 | Monday |
Christmas | 25th December 2023 | Monday |

(B) For Banks
(The Following holiday is limited for the Banks only. This holiday is not admissible to the Government Offices.)
- To enable to Banks to close their yearly accounts – 1st April 2023 – Saturday
By order and in the name of the Governor of Maharashtra,
J. J. VALVI,
Deputy Secretary to Government.
GENERAL ADMINISTRATION DEPARTMENT
Mantralaya, Madam Cama Road, Hutatma Rajguru Chowk,
Mumbai 400 032, dated the 2nd December 2022.
NOTIFICATION
No. PHD. 1122/C.R. 117/Desk-29.— The Government of Maharashtra has separately declared 24 Public Holidays for the year 2023 notified the section 25 of the Negotiable Instruments Act, 1881 (XXIV of 1881) as per Notification No. PHD. 1122/C.R. 117/Desk-29, Dated 2nd December 2022.
2. The State Government has also decided to declare following additional holiday for the offices of the State Government, State Public Sector undertakings, Municipal Corporation, Municipal Council, Nagar Panchayat, Zilla Parishad, Panchayat Samittee and Village Panchayat
- Bhaubeej – 15th November 2023 – Wednesday
By order and in the name of the Governor of Maharashtra,
J. J. VALVI,
Deputy Secretary to Government.
